More storage in Xbox 360

Kudlaty14

Hello. My Xbox 360 has got a little storage inside and I want to increase it by plugging in another HDD from outside by SATA input. My question is: does Xbox decipher this hard drive? I'm not going to use drive from Microsoft, only from another firm (Western City for example), because it's too expensive.

Hey there :)

 

The console needs a supported drive as an internal one. However, you can add external drives via the USB port for expanding the storage space and the connection speed is perfectly good for a smooth gaming sessions. I could suggest checking out WD Elements Portable, WD Elements Desktop and WD My Passport X as all three drives are fully compatible with the console and should work great for expanding its capacity. The Passport X is specifically designed for that purposes are requires no formatting or setting up before you can store your games on it.
